Released in 1925, The Gold Rush is often cited by critics—and by himself—as the film he most wanted to be remembered for. It follows his iconic Little Tramp character as a lone prospector seeking fortune in the snowy Klondike.

There are two main versions of this film. The 1925 Original Silent Version (usually preferred by purists) and the 1942 Re-release , for which Chaplin added a musical score and his own narration while trimming some scenes. Most high-quality BluRay "Repacks" include both versions.

A masterclass in pantomime where Chaplin "animates" two bread rolls on forks to perform a ballet.
